Other biblical texts which mention greed include: Exodus 20:17, Proverbs 11:24, Proverbs 28:25, Ecclesiastes 5:10, Philippians 4:6 and 1 Timothy 6:9-10.Ĭharity cures greed by putting the desire to help others above storing up treasure for one’s self. For He Himself has said, ‘I will never leave you nor forsake you.’” The Bible says the following in Hebrews 13:5, “Let your conduct be without covetousness be content with such things as you have. Greed is an excessive pursuit of material goods. Temperance cures gluttony by implanting the desire to be healthy, therefore making one fit to serve others. Gluttony is an excessive and ongoing eating of food or drink.ġ Corinthians 10:31 says, “Therefore, whether you eat or drink, or whatever you do, do all to the glory of God.”Īdditional Bible references include: Psalm 78:17-19, Philippians 3:19-20, Proverbs 23:1-3, Proverbs 23:19-21 and 1 Corinthians 3:16-17. The Bible also mentions lust in the following verses: Job 31:1, Matthew 5:28, Philippians 4:8, James 1:14-15, 1 Peter 2:11 and 1 John 2:16.Ĭhastity or self-control cures lust by controlling passion and leveraging that energy for the good of others. The Bible speaks about lust in 2 Timothy 2:22, “Flee also youthful lusts but pursue righteousness, faith, love peace.” Lust is a strong passion or longing, especially for sexual desires.
